Gilbert: What is The Venus Mantrap about?
Bruce Capoferri: The Venus Mantrap is a story set in a dystopian future when humanity has begun mining and colonizing other planets in our solar system. During the course of terraforming Venus enough to reduce the temperature, indigenous plants are awakened, ultimately resulting in alien-human hybrids. Being intelligent, these creatures immigrate to Earth. The murder of one leads to a darkly humorous mystery full of twists and turns, involving a Detective who must solve the case in order to clear himself and win back his childhood sweetheart.
Gilbert: What was your inspiration for the book?
Bruce Capoferri: Similar to the style of Ian Fleming, I love playing with names, words and phrases. I also enjoy writing science fiction/horror with humor. The name of my lead character is not only a prime example of this, but was the joke that also inspired the story. If you don’t guess the joke immediately (which I hope you won’t), it is revealed at the end. This prompted Barbara, my wife, to ask if I had written the whole story just for the punchline? And the answer is YES!
